The ingredients needed to make Matar Chole | Peas Curry:
  1. Get 400 grams fresh peas or frozen
  2. Make ready 1 big onion
  3. Take 1 big tomato
  4. Take 1 tsp ginger garlic paste
  5. Make ready leaves few coriander
  6. Take 1 tsp red chilli powder
  7. Get 1 tbsp coriander powder
  8. Take 1 tsp cumin seeds
  9. Make ready 1/2 tsp turmeric
  10. Make ready to taste salt
  11. Make ready 1/2 tsp garam masala powder

Instructions to make Matar Chole | Peas Curry:
  1. Heat a tsp oil in a pan sautey onions till light golden on medium flame watch full video on my youtube channel https://youtu.be/XViMrmWDghQ
  2. Add tomatoes mix well cover and simmer till tomatoes are soft then add coriander leaves mix well remove from heat cool and grind into a fine paste
  3. Heat a tbsp oil in cooker or vessel add cumin seeds once they splutter add ginger garlic sautey few seconds add all powder spices except garam masala powder mix well
  4. If masala is sticking to bottom add a tbsp water and sautey for few seconds then add the onion tomato masala paste
  5. Cook until masala is dry add peas and sautey for 2 to 3 minutes on high heat fry well till all masala is coated well with peas
  6. Add water as required and close cooker lid pressure cook for3 to 4 whistles till peas are soft
  7. Open cooker once pressure is gone take out 2 tbsp of peas and coarse grind them then add it back into the gravy it will give a good thickening add garam masala powder and chopped coriander leaves mix well
  8. Simmer few minutes then serve with poori paratha phulka chapati
